Private Tour to the Highlights of Kyrenia
Best for: Travelers who want an all-inclusive private day with lunch, entrance fees, and a broader Kyrenia itinerary.
This premium private experience is the most comprehensive of the three, with a longer day built around several Kyrenia-area stops. The included items are broad: private transportation, a professional licensed tourist guide, entrance fees to all attractions, bottled water, lunch, and a traditional beverage. Hotel pickup and drop-off are not included. The itinerary describes a sequence that begins with St. Hilarion Castle, continues to Bellapais Abbey, then moves to Kyrenia Castle and the Shipwreck Museum, followed by Kyrenia Old Harbour and the Old Town. It is a good fit for travelers who want a guided, all-in-one day rather than a shorter transfer-style outing.

3-hour Nicosia Segway Tour
Best for: Travelers who want a shorter, more active way to see Old Nicosia with brief stops and photo opportunities.
This is the only option that stays in Nicosia and uses a Segway for the sightseeing format. The tour begins with comprehensive Segway training, then follows a route through Old Nicosia with brief stops for explanations and photos. Included items are a local guide, bottled water, coffee and/or tea, and VAT. The description also mentions a refreshment and snack break in the middle of the tour. The listed options separate morning, afternoon, and evening departures by season, but the route concept stays the same. It suits travelers who want a quicker, more active overview of Old Nicosia rather than a seated private drive.
